The Function of Strictly Necessary Cookies
You are unable to switch these cookies off, and for good reason. They’re what keep the lights on. At Jet4Bet, they take care of the basics: maintaining your session securely while you play, protecting your money when you deposit, and remembering what you put in your betting slip. They don’t track you for ads. They just make sure the site works and your account remains secure. Without them, the whole platform would be unreliable.

The Consequences of Deactivating Performance Cookies
We turned off the Performance cookies to see what would happen. These are the ones that collect anonymous information about how people use the site—which pages are slow, where folks have trouble, that sort of thing. With them off, we did notice the site was a tiny bit less responsive during busy times, like when switching between the live casino and the data-api.marketindex.com.au slots lobby. Everything continued to work, but the refinement was missing. It shows how those cookies aid the tech team fix the wrinkles.
